/src/index.ts:
--------------------------------------------------------------------------------
1 | import { createMiddleware } from "hono/factory";
2 | import type { Context, Next } from "hono";
3 | import { HTTPException } from "hono/http-exception";
4 |
5 | const RATE_LIMIT_CONTEXT_KEY = ".rateLimited";
6 | const STATUS_TOO_MANY_REQUESTS = 429;
7 |
8 | export interface RateLimitBinding {
9 | limit: LimitFunc;
10 | }
11 |
12 | export interface LimitFunc {
13 | (options: LimitOptions): Promise;
14 | }
15 |
16 | interface RateLimitResult {
17 | success: boolean;
18 | }
19 |
20 | export interface LimitOptions {
21 | key: string;
22 | }
23 |
24 | export interface RateLimitResponse {
25 | key: string;
26 | success: boolean;
27 | }
28 |
29 | export interface RateLimitOptions {
30 | continueOnRateLimit: boolean;
31 | }
32 |
33 | export type RateLimitKeyFunc = {
34 | (c: Context): string;
35 | };
36 |
37 | export const rateLimit = (rateLimitBinding: RateLimitBinding, keyFunc: RateLimitKeyFunc) => {
38 | return createMiddleware(async (c: Context, next: Next) => {
39 | let key = keyFunc(c);
40 | if (!key) {
41 | console.warn("the provided keyFunc returned an empty rate limiting key: bypassing rate limits");
42 | }
43 | if (key) {
44 | let { success } = await rateLimitBinding.limit({ key: key });
45 | c.set(RATE_LIMIT_CONTEXT_KEY, success);
46 |
47 | if (!success) {
48 | throw new HTTPException(STATUS_TOO_MANY_REQUESTS, {
49 | res: c.text("rate limited", { status: STATUS_TOO_MANY_REQUESTS }),
50 | });
51 | }
52 | }
53 |
54 | // Call the next handler/middleware in the stack on success
55 | await next();
56 | });
57 | };
58 |
59 | export const wasRateLimited = (c: Context): boolean => {
60 | return c.get(RATE_LIMIT_CONTEXT_KEY) as boolean;
61 | };
62 |

/README.md:
--------------------------------------------------------------------------------
1 | # @elithrar/workers-hono-rate-limit
2 | [](https://github.com/elithrar/workers-hono-rate-limit/actions/workflows/test.yml)
3 |
4 | `@elithrar/workers-hono-rate-limit` is Hono middleware that allows you to use Cloudflare Worker's [rate limiting bindings](https://developers.cloudflare.com/workers/runtime-apis/bindings/rate-limit/) directly in your Hono applications.
5 |
6 | ## Install
7 |
8 | To install this into your Hono project:
9 |
10 | ```sh
11 | $ npm install @elithrar/workers-hono-rate-limit
12 | ```
13 |
14 | ## Usage
15 |
16 | To use the rate limiter middleware:
17 |
18 | 1. Create a [rate limiting binding](#) in your `wrangler.toml` configuration
19 | 2. Define a `RateLimitKeyFunc`: this is a function that returns the key to rate limit on for a given request. A `RateLimitKeyFunc` is simply a function that accepts a Hono `Context` and returns a `string`.
20 | 3. Apply the `rateLimit` middleware to your application or routes.
21 |
22 | The below example shows how to use the `rateLimit` middleware within a Hono app:
23 |
24 | ```toml
25 | # wrangler.toml
26 |
27 | [[unsafe.bindings]]
28 | name = "RATE_LIMITER"
29 | type = "ratelimit"
30 | namespace_id = "1001"
31 | # 20 requests per 10 seconds
32 | simple = { limit = 25, period = 10 }
33 | ```
34 |
35 | Your corresponding Hono-based Worker would then resemble this:
36 |
37 | ```ts
38 | import { rateLimit, RateLimitBinding, RateLimitKeyFunc } from "@elithrar/workers-hono-rate-limit";
39 | import { Hono, Context, Next } from "hono";
40 |
41 | type Bindings = {
42 | RATE_LIMITER: RateLimitBinding;
43 | };
44 |
45 | const app = new Hono<{ Bindings: Bindings }>();
46 |
47 | // Your RateLimitKeyFunc returns the key to rate-limit on.
48 | // It has access to everything in the Hono Context, including
49 | // URL path parameters, query parameters, headers, the request body,
50 | // and context values set by other middleware.
51 | const getKey: RateLimitKeyFunc = (c: Context): string => {
52 | // Rate limit on each API token by returning it as the key for our
53 | // middleware to use.
54 | return c.req.header("Authorization") || "";
55 | };
56 |
57 | // Create an instance of our rate limiter, passing it the Rate Limiting bindings
58 | const rateLimiter = async (c: Context, next: Next) => {
59 | return await rateLimit(c.env.RATE_LIMITER, getKey)(c, next);
60 | };
61 |
62 | // Rate limit all routes across our application
63 | app.use("*", rateLimiter);
64 | app.get("/", (c) => {
65 | return c.text("hello!");
66 | });
67 |
68 | export default app;
69 | ```
70 |
71 | You can create multiple `rateLimit` instances, passing in different rate-limiting configurations and a `RateLimitKeyFunc` for each use-case, or apply the same `rateLimit` function to multiple route patterns via `app.use`.
72 |
73 | For example, you might more aggressively rate-limit requests to an `/admin` endpoint and rate limit on the email address provided the `POST` request body vs. a higher, more permissive rate-limit for public routes.
74 |
75 | ## Notes
76 |
77 | - The `keyFunc` that determines what to limit a request on should represent a unique characteristic of a user or class of user that you wish to rate limit. Good choices include API keys in `Authorization` headers, URL paths or routes, specific query parameters used by your application, and/or user IDs.
78 | - It is not recommended to use IP addresses (since these can be shared by many users in many valid cases) or locations (the same), as you may find yourself unintentionally rate limiting a wider group of users than you intended.
79 | - If your provided `keyFunc` does not return a key and instead returns an empty string, the `rateLimit` middleware will not be invoked for the current request.
80 |
